FOOTBALL MATCH ST ANNES VERSUS MAHOGANY RISE 12/8/2022 ROUND 4

 

SCORES:

 

St Anne’s: 3 goals, 9 behinds, Total 27

 

Mahogany Rise: 4 goals, 5 behinds Total 29

 

This week the team travelled to Eric Bell Reserve, Pines for a match up against another very good opposition. 

 

We played 4 x 10-minute quarters and supplied three of our students to Mahogany Rise each quarter to even up the sides in numbers as Mahogany Rise only had twelve players.

 

Gak got the first score of the match booting a behind for Mahogany. Kingston was getting a heap of the footy and having some blistering runs with the ball.

 

In the second quarter we had Charlie kick a nice goal from a snapshot a fair way out as well as Kingston chiming in for a lovely running goal.

 

Harry was starring for St Anne’s with his first game in the jumper being exceptional. Cooper kicked a behind for Mahogany Rise and he had a huge celebration letting everyone on the field know of his skillful exploits.

 

In the third quarter Nick and Jack were gathering possessions at will, with Jack collecting the football on the wing dodging three opposition players bouncing and having a shot for goal which narrowly missed. Nick managed a hard ball get in the forward 20-meter area and bustled through a tackle to kick our first major for the quarter.

 

Hazel and Sai were playing well in the midfield and Seb was tackling ferociously. Griffin relished his move to full forward and managed to kick a behind which he reckons he will be able to go one better with next week and kick a goal.

 

Jos, Isaac, Sia, Jax, Alex and Patrick were all battling hard and did their bit to keep us in the game with great defence.

 

In the last quarter Sam was rock solid in defence doing a great job for the coach by stopping all forward thrusts and rebounding to our advantage. In the end we came up two points short of a win in an epic encounter. After the game we got to celebrate Nick and Cooper’s birthday by putting them into the circle and singing happy birthday after a rousing rendition of the school song had been sung.
